My computer suddenly restarts while I was using Internet
Explorer, this happened more than once. I tried to check
what caused it, but couldn't find anything. Microsoft
Error Report said that it is a device driver error. I
couldn't find anything about that too. Someone please
help. thank you.


here is the computer hardwares:
Asus P4P800 Deluxe motherboard
Pentium 4 HT 2.6C
Geil 512 DDRAM PC3200
ATI Radeon 9600XT
3Com Gigabyte Network Card

someone tell me if there is any conflict with the
hardwares.
 
Hardware problems often caused by heat.
Clean the fan in the back of the computer and make sure the CPU fan on the
motherboard is OK.
